b- What is Game ID and how to locate it via r4cce?
i)My explanation would be Game ID is the identity of a game! It should be unique and no two different games should share a same Game ID
ii)In order for the cheat codes to show up on your cheat menu, the Game ID of your database should be the same as your game’s Game ID! Otherwise you won’t see any codes on your cheat menu.
iii)A little addon from dsrules about game ID
"Game ID: is composed by two parts, the first 4 letters are for the game "Game code", the last 8 hexadecimal numbers for the game crc code, used for the match of the cheat and the corresponding game."
yes, M3Real also recognize the first 4 letters as the game id and the last 8 are ignored, that's why patched games with different crc code don't affect the M3Real or iTouch
iv)Common problem/mistake
For example a patched / dubbed rom’s Game ID might be different from the clean rom! If both the IDs are different it will cause cheats doesn’t show up on menu (this doesn't affect M3real or iTouch users)
